Description: S3 Download Manager is a free open source download manager for Windows. It allows you to download files, videos, torrents and more with speeds up to 10 times faster than a regular browser by using multiple connections.
Type: software
Pricing: Open Source
Description: Download Statusbar is a free open source browser extension that displays the download progress and speed directly on the browser's status bar. It works across all major browsers like Chrome, Firefox, Safari, Opera and Edge.
Type: software
Pricing: Open Source